From 2b50ab2aee75d3c361fcd1eb39e830e2e73056b6 Mon Sep 17 00:00:00 2001 From: fanzha02 Date: Mon, 7 Dec 2020 19:15:15 +0800 Subject: cmd/compile: optimize single-precision floating point square root Add generic rule to rewrite the single-precision square root expression with one single-precision instruction. The optimization will reduce two times of precision converting between double-precision and single-precision. On arm64 flatform. previous: FCVTSD F0, F0 FSQRTD F0, F0 FCVTDS F0, F0 optimized: FSQRTS S0, S0 And this patch adds the test case to check the correctness.
